2017-04-05 1 views
-1

리소스 그룹이 "cbp.resourcegroup.neu"입니다. 예약 된 IP와 VM이 모두 동일한 리소스 그룹에 있습니다. 예약 된 IP 이름이 CBPIP-Dev-NEU 에 대한 서비스 이름입니다. 기계 VM 내가 하늘에있는 기존 VM에 예약 된 IP 추가

Set-AzureReservedIPAssociation -ReservedIPName Group cbp.resourcegroup.neu 
CBPIP-Dev-NEU -ServiceName portrtestmachine 

VM

에 예약 된 IP를 추가하려면 다음 명령을 실행하고 때 내가

"testmachine.northeurope.cloudapp.azure.com"DNS 이름의 첫 번째 부분으로에서 찍은하는 testmachine입니다 다음과 같은 오류가 발생합니다.

Set-AzureReservedIPAssociation : Cannot validate argument on parameter 
'Slot'. The argument "CBPIP-Dev-NEU" does not belong to the set 
"Staging,Production" specified by the ValidateSet attribute. Supply an 
argument that is in 
the set and then try the command again. 
At line:1 char:76 
+ ... ion -ReservedIPName Group cbp.resourcegroup.neu CBPIP-Dev-NEU -Servic 
... 
+              ~~~~~~~~~~~~~ 
+ CategoryInfo   : InvalidData: (:) [Set-AzureReservedIPAssociation], ParameterBindingValidationException 
+ FullyQualifiedErrorId : ParameterArgumentValidationError,Microsoft.WindowsAzure.Commands.ServiceManagement.IaaS.SetAzureReservedIPAssociationCmdlet 

내 명령에 누락 된 것이 있습니까? 나는 그것을하기 위해 파워 쉘을 사용했다.

답변

0
Group cbp.resourcegroup.neu CBPIP-Dev-NEU 

공간이 명령은 위치 paramters를 사용하고 생각하게, 그래서 "CBPIP - 데브 - NEU는"이 유효한 값이 아닙니다 인의 -Slot 매개 변수에 전달되고있다.

이 대신

Set-AzureReservedIPAssociation -ReservedIPName "CBPIP-Dev-NEU" -ServiceName "portrtestmachine" 
+0

아니요. 작동하지 않았습니다. 여기에 오류가 있습니다. "Set-AzureReservedIPAssociation : ResourceNotFound : 배치를 찾을 수 없습니다." –

+0

단순히 명령에 잘못된 이름을 지정했음을 의미합니다. 리소스가 호출 된 것을 다시 확인하지만 그렇지 않은 경우 명령이 올바르다는 것을 의미합니다. – CodedBeard

0

하늘빛은 IP 만 배포 생산 인스턴스에 할당 할 수 있습니다 예약하십시오.

하지만 쓸모가 없으므로 CloudServices 에 이미에 정적 IP가 있습니다.

클라우드 서비스를 확인하고 정적 공용 IP 주소가 없는지 확인해야합니다.

관련 문제